Wiktionary
provenadjective
Having been proved; having proved its value or truth.
Antonyms:
unproven

PPDB, the paraphrase database
List of paraphrases for "proven":
proved, demonstrated, tested, shown, audited, verified, substantiated, revealed, evidenced, pre-tested
